A self-hosted, real-time team chat service in the spirit of Slack/Discord/ Mattermost (channel-based, no threaded conversations) — built from scratch as a full-stack solo project, running in production on my own infrastructure rather than as a demo. Invite-only: there's no public sign-up, every account comes from an admin invite or a room invite. See ARCHITECTURE.md for the full system design and phased build plan.

Features
- Auth & accounts — session-based auth, invite-only signup (admin-issued site invites or room invites, both delivered by email), password reset, per-user light/dark/midnight/sunset presets plus a live theme builder for fully custom, named, savable color themes.
- Rooms — open and private rooms, owner/admin/member roles, invites, room browsing/search, file/image galleries per room.
- Real-time chat — WebSocket-based messaging with automatic reconnect and backoff, Markdown rendering, @mentions with autocomplete and inline highlighting, emoji reactions, message editing, image and file attachments (drag-and-drop, paste, or picker) with inline previews for images/PDFs/text/Markdown, unread indicators, and presence (online/away/ offline, with a manual "appear offline" override).
- Notifications — Web Push for offline/backgrounded members, with per-type opt-in/out (mentions vs. all messages), plus in-app unread badges.
- PWA — installable, offline-capable (cached room/message data, a dedicated offline banner), with automatic update detection that prompts a reload as soon as a new deploy goes live.
- Admin portal — user management, site invites, SMTP configuration, audit log, and management of the bot/webhook system below.
- Bots & integrations — scoped API tokens for bot accounts, incoming webhooks (post into a room from an external system) and outgoing webhooks (signed HMAC event delivery on message create/update), all with SSRF protection on any admin-supplied external URL.
- Scale-out — Redis-backed pub/sub for WebSocket fan-out and presence, so the app runs across multiple horizontally-scaled instances rather than a single process.
Tech stack
- Backend: Python, FastAPI, SQLAlchemy 2.0 (fully async), PostgreSQL, Redis, Alembic migrations, argon2 password hashing, Web Push (VAPID).
- Frontend: React 19, TypeScript, Vite, a hand-rolled WebSocket client with reconnect/backoff and visibility-aware presence, a PWA service worker (Workbox) for offline caching and push.
- Deployment: two bare Debian 13 servers (app + DB/cache), no containers — see DEPLOYMENT.md.

Quickstart
# 1. Postgres (see backend/README.md for details)
docker run -d --name ds-chat-postgres \
-e POSTGRES_USER=ds_chat -e POSTGRES_PASSWORD=ds_chat -e POSTGRES_DB=ds_chat \
-p 5432:5432 postgres:16-alpine
# 2. Redis (required — used for cross-instance WebSocket fan-out and presence)
docker run -d --name ds-chat-redis -p 6379:6379 redis:7-alpine
# 3. Backend
cd backend
python3 -m venv .venv
.venv/bin/pip install -e ".[dev]"
cp .env.example .env # then set SESSION_SECRET
.venv/bin/alembic upgrade head
.venv/bin/python -m app.cli create-user alice alice@example.com "some-password"
.venv/bin/uvicorn app.main:app --reload &
# 4. Frontend (in another shell)
cd frontend
npm install
npm run dev
Then open http://localhost:5173 and log in with the account created above.
The Vite dev server proxies /api and /ws to the backend on :8000, so no
CORS configuration is needed in development.
